Data Intelligence Compliance Consultant

Remote Full-time
About the position As a Mastery Level Data Intelligence Consultant, you will have an opportunity join a transformational analytics team comprised of technical resources with a wealth of business knowledge. You will partner with your peers to deliver exceptional data and technology driven solutions for the Compliance and Ethics Organization. The right candidate will be excited by the prospect of solving complex problems, is driven to enable users to succeed, and can build effective stakeholder relationships by leveraging their process-driven, analytical, technical, and business acumen skills. The team focuses on creating data driven intelligence to inform our internal compliance and business partners of potential risk exposures in the regulatory, industry and economic environments. We use an industry leading combination of data visualization and data analytics to blend extensive amounts of data into digestible and actionable information, giving leaders and associates information they need to make tactical and strategic decisions. Responsibilities • Extract data from a range of data sources to conduct analysis, perform data modeling, and develop reporting to support compliance and risk mitigation strategies. • Analyze data to deliver descriptive, diagnostic, and prescriptive analytics to stakeholders for risk mitigation and decision support. • Identify, learn, understand, and implement new analytic concepts and data management frameworks. • Understand the data lifecycle to help our compliance partners appreciate their data and develop actionable solutions. • Translate complex business questions into problems that can be solved through data. • Communicate data in a storytelling format, engaging your audience and imploring them to act. • Ensure data is managed across multiple sources and that relationships are understood throughout a variety of uses of data. • Build strong and enduring relationships with compliance and business partners, promoting trust and collaboration. • Proactively partner with compliance teams to identify opportunities to strategically leverage data to enhance compliance programs and report on and mitigate risk. • Be self-directed and comfortable supporting the data needs of multiple teams, systems, business lines, and products. • Manage own personal and professional development; seek opportunities for professional growth and expansion of technical/consulting skills and experience. Requirements • Bachelor's degree or a Business Analytics Certification (or equivalent experience). • 3+ years' experience communicating data to leaders. • 3+ years' experience utilizing visualization tools such as Tableau, MicroStrategy, Power BI, or similar Business Intelligence tools. • Ability to pass a non-registered fingerprint background check to qualify as a fingerprinted person under FINRA. Nice-to-haves • BS degree in an analytical field. • Experience applying statistics principles to business data to generate insight. • Prior experience utilizing Python and SQL Server, Vertica, etc. in an analytics setting. • Advanced knowledge of SQL concepts (joins, functions, stored procedures, CTEs, etc.). • Deep desire and motivation to learn innovative technologies and ideas. •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ities. • Understands the fundamentals of the financial services industry to make sound recommendations that may have business impacts. • Strong written, oral, and collaborative communication skills. • Self-directed and able to work under ambiguous circumstances. Benefits • Competitive salaries, along with incentive and bonus opportunities. • Access to mentorship opportunities. • Networking opportunities including access to various Business Resource Groups. • Access to learning content on Degreed and other informational platforms.
